What is the cheapest month to fly from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to South Pacific?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to South Pacific,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to South Pacific is May, when tickets cost C$ 1,971 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and January,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 2,589 and C$ 2,569 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to South Pacific?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to South Pacific,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on a flight from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to South Pacific, you should book around 8 weeks before departure, which saves you about 20%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 22 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Montreal to South Pacific?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Montreal to South Pacific with an airline and back with another airline.
